Date: | Friday 29 March 1985 |
Time: | 16:30 LT |
Type: | Cessna 188 |
Owner/operator: | Edward Tadlock Jr.& V.tadlock |
Registration: | N9959G |
MSN: | 18800759 |
Year of manufacture: | 1971 |
Total airframe hrs: | 1500 hours |
Engine model: | CONTINENTAL IO-520D |
Fatalities: |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 1 |
Aircraft damage: | Substantial |
Category: | Accident |
Location: | Osage City, KS -
United States of America
|
Phase: | Landing |
Nature: | Training |
Departure airport: | Osage City, KS (53K) |
Destination airport: | |
Investigating agency: | NTSB |
Confidence Rating: | Accident investigation report completed and information captured |
Narrative:THE PLT WAS PRACTICING LANDING AT THE AIRPORT WHEN DURING THE LANDING ROLL ON THE THIRD ATTEMPT AT LANDING THE ACFT SWERVED OFF THE RWY. THE ACFT GROUND LOOPED AFTER DEPARTING THE RWY AND SUSTAINED SUBSTANTIAL DAMAGE. THE PLT RPTD THE BRAKES GRABBED ASYMETRICALLY PULLING THE ACFT OFF THE RWY. WITNESSES STATED THE PLT HAD DIFFICULTY HANDLING THE ACFT DURING THE LANDING ATTEMPTS. NO MECHANICAL DESCREPANCY WAS NOTED BY A VISUAL INSPECTION OF THE ACFT.
